GitHubは、OpenAIの最新モデルであるo1シリーズをGitHub CopilotとGitHub Modelsに導入することを発表した。この画期的な統合により、開発者は高度な AI 支援を受けながら、より効率的にコーディングを行うことが可能になる。
GitHubによるOpenAI o1モデルの導入
GitHubは、OpenAIのo1-previewとo1-miniという2つの新しいAIモデルを、GitHub CopilotとGitHub Modelsの両方で利用可能にするプレビューを開始した。この新機能により、開発者はVisual Studio CodeでのGitHub Copilot Chatや、GitHub Modelsのプレイグラウンドでこれらの高度なモデルを試すことができる。
o1シリーズは、複雑なタスクを内部的な思考プロセスを用いて推論する能力を持つ、OpenAIの最新AIモデルだ。GitHubチームによると、o1-previewモデルをCopilotで使用した際、コードの制約やエッジケースをより深く理解し、効率的で高品質な結果を生み出すことが確認されている。
開発者は、VS CodeのCopilot Chatで現在のデフォルトモデルであるGPT-4oの代わりに、o1-previewまたはo1-miniを選択して使用することができる。さらに、会話の途中でモデルを切り替えることも可能だ。これにより、APIの簡単な説明やボイラープレートコードの生成から、複雑なアルゴリズムの設計やロジックバグの分析まで、幅広いタスクに柔軟に対応できる。
GitHub Modelsのプレイグラウンドでは、開発者がo1モデルの独自の機能とパフォーマンスを探索し、理解を深めることができる。これは、将来的に開発者自身のアプリケーションにo1モデルを統合する際の重要なステップとなる。
OpenAI o1モデルの特徴と利点
o1シリーズの最大の特徴は、その高度な推論能力にある。これらのモデルは、応答する前により多くの時間を費やして「考える」ように設計されている。この特性により、科学、コーディング、数学などの分野で、これまでのOpenAIモデルよりも難しい問題を解決することができる。
o1-previewモデルは、コードの制約とエッジケースに対する深い理解を示す。これにより、より効率的で高品質な結果を生み出すことが可能になる。また、o1-previewの慎重で目的に沿った応答は、問題の特定と迅速な解決策の実装を容易にする。
GitHubは、開発者がo1-previewとo1-miniを使用して、Copilotと共にソフトウェア開発を行ったり、次世代のLLMベースの製品を構築したりすることを奨励している。この新しいプレビューにより、OpenAIの最新の進歩を直接開発者に提供することが可能になった。
さらに、OpenAIは最近、o1-previewとo1-miniのAPIの制限を大幅に引き上げた。o1-preview APIは現在、1分間に500リクエストをサポートし、o1-mini APIは1分間に1000リクエストをサポートしている。OpenAIチームは、さらなる制限の引き上げとより多くの開発者層へのAPI アクセスの拡大に取り組んでいる。
消費者向けでは、ChatGPT EnterpriseとChatGPT Eduの顧客全てにo1-previewとo1-miniモデルが利用可能になった。o1-miniの制限は週50メッセージから1日50メッセージへと7倍に増加し、o1-previewの制限も週30メッセージから週50メッセージに増加している。
コメント